Current jobs related to Senior Python Developer Lead - Ottawa, Ontario - Arthur J. Gallagher & Co. (AJG)


  • Ottawa, Ontario, Canada Nearform Full time

    About NearformNearform is an independent team of engineers, designers, data experts and strategists who build intelligent digital solutions and capability at pace. We create software solutions that enhance digital experiences, empower developers, and deliver measurable results. Our deep expertise in solving the world's most complex digital problems, along...


  • Ottawa, Ontario, Canada Lumenalta Full time

    Join Lumenalta, a pioneer in IT Services and IT Consulting, and take advantage of a unique opportunity to work on projects that push the boundaries of technology.We are seeking an experienced Data Engineer to lead the development of cutting-edge data solutions using Python and Pyspark/AWS/Databricks.The successful candidate will have 7+ years of experience...


  • Ottawa, Ontario, Canada Algobrain Full time

    About Algobrain:We are a leading provider of financial technology solutions, dedicated to delivering cutting-edge software products that meet the evolving needs of our clients. Our team consists of talented professionals who share a passion for innovation and excellence. As a Senior Java, Python, C++ Developer, you will be part of a collaborative and dynamic...


  • Ottawa, Ontario, Canada Nearform Full time

    About the RoleWe are seeking a Senior Python Software Engineer to join our Engineering function. As a member of our team, you will work closely with clients to translate complex business requirements into innovative digital products. Your main task will be designing & building applications using Python.Supporting component design, development and maintenance...


  • Ottawa, Ontario, Canada Procom Full time

    Senior Recruiting Specialist and Team Lead at ProcomAutomation Test Developer1-year+ contract. On-site work in OttawaOn behalf of our client, Procom is looking for an Automation Test Developer, with Python and embedded system test experience.In this role you will develop automated test tools, libraries, and scripts and maintain test...


  • Ottawa, Ontario, Canada Nearform Full time

    About UsNearform is an independent team of engineers, designers, data experts and strategists who build intelligent digital solutions and capability at pace. We create software solutions that enhance digital experiences, empower developers, and deliver measurable results.We partner with ambitious enterprises to deliver enduring impact. Our deep expertise in...


  • Ottawa, Ontario, Canada Nutreco Full time

    About Us:Nutreco is a leading animal nutrition company that seeks talented individuals to contribute to its success. We value diversity and equality in the workplace.The Job:We are looking for an experienced Senior Power Platform Developer/Architect to join our team as a key contributor in designing, developing, and maintaining scalable full-stack...


  • Ottawa, Ontario, Canada Ezofis Inc Full time

    Job Description:We are seeking a highly skilled Senior Developer to join our team at Ezofis Inc. The ideal candidate will have extensive experience in developing Python-based applications and software solutions.Main Responsibilities:- Design, develop, test, and maintain Python-based applications- Collaborate with cross-functional teams to identify and...


  • Ottawa, Ontario, Canada Procom Full time

    We are looking for a skilled Python Developer to lead our automation testing efforts. The successful candidate will have a proven track record of delivering high-quality automated test solutions using Python.This role requires collaboration with cross-functional teams to identify and prioritize testing needs. The ideal candidate will have a deep...


  • Ottawa, Ontario, Canada Nearform Full time

    Senior Python Software Engineer (Perm, Romania, Remote)This is a permanent full time remote opportunity for those based in Romania.About NearformNearform is an independent team of engineers, designers, data experts and strategists who build intelligent digital solutions and capability at pace. We create software solutions that enhance digital experiences,...


  • Ottawa, Ontario, Canada Nearform Full time

    About YouWe are looking for someone with significant experience delivering at a Senior Engineer level, typically with at least 6 years' commercial experience. You should have practical experience of delivering in an agile environment, developing real-world solutions and deep knowledge of the Python language. Additionally, you should have a deep understanding...


  • Ottawa, Ontario, Canada Qualitest Full time

    About the RoleWe are seeking a highly skilled C# and Python Developer to join our team in the medical device domain. The ideal candidate will have hands-on experience developing and testing software for medical devices, with a strong focus on compliance with regulatory standards.This role involves working closely with cross-functional teams to develop,...

  • Python Developer

    6 days ago


    Ottawa, Ontario, Canada Collabera Full time

    About CollaberaCollabera is the largest minority-owned Information Technology (IT) staffing firm in the U.S., with more than $525 million in sales revenue and a global presence that represents approximately 10,000 professionals across North America (U.S., Canada), Asia Pacific (India, Philippines, Singapore, Malaysia) and the United Kingdom. We support our...


  • Ottawa, Ontario, Canada Ezofis Inc Full time

    About the Role: Ezofis Inc. is seeking a skilled Senior Developer to join our team of talented software engineers. This position involves developing, testing, and maintaining Python-based applications and software solutions.Key Responsibilities:- Develop clean, efficient, and reusable code following best practices- Collaborate with cross-functional teams to...


  • Ottawa, Ontario, Canada Red Oak Technologies Full time

    At Red Oak Technologies, we are a leading provider of comprehensive resourcing solutions across various industries and sectors. Our solution is based on deep learning, machine vision, and lidar. We want to alert cities to issues so that they can quickly take informed action.You will be responsible for designing and developing the backend infrastructure used...


  • Ottawa, Ontario, Canada Ezofis Inc Full time

    Company Overview:Ezofis Inc. is a leading provider of software solutions, specializing in delivering innovative and reliable products. We are seeking a skilled Senior Developer to join our team of talented professionals. As a Senior Developer, you will be responsible for developing, testing, and maintaining Python-based applications and software...

  • C# Python Developer

    6 days ago


    Ottawa, Ontario, Canada Qualitest Full time

    Are you interested in working with the World's leading AI-powered Quality Engineering Company? Ready to advance your career, team up with global thought leaders across industries and make a difference every day? Join us at QualitestWe are looking for a C# Python Developer to join our growing team in Indianola, PA (on-site).Top 3 Must HavesProficiency in C#...


  • Ottawa, Ontario, Canada Creative Clicks Full time

    Creative Clicks is dedicated to revolutionizing online advertising with pioneering software solutions. As a leading technology company with headquarters in downtown San Francisco and global presence, we're seeking a seasoned Python developer to spearhead our next generation of products.This pivotal role requires collaboration with our expert engineers to...


  • Ottawa, Ontario, Canada High Tech Genesis Full time

    At High Tech Genesis, we are seeking a skilled Senior Technical Lead to join our dynamic team. As a key member of our engineering group, you will play a crucial role in shaping the future of our products.The ideal candidate will have a strong background in software development and architecture design, with experience in leading teams and collaborating with...


  • Ottawa, Ontario, Canada Procom Full time

    Automation Test Developer1-year+ contract. On-site work in OttawaOn behalf of our client, Procom is looking for an Automation Test Developer, with Python and embedded system test experience.In this role you will develop automated test tools, libraries, and scripts and maintain test suites.Responsibilities-Interface with development and test teams to...

Senior Python Developer Lead

2 weeks ago


Ottawa, Ontario, Canada Arthur J. Gallagher & Co. (AJG) Full time

Overview

Gallagher Bassett is searching for a meticulous and experienced Sr. Data Integration (ETL) Developer to join our talented team. Your central responsibility as the Data Architect will be to develop, optimize and oversee conceptual and logical data systems.

Job Description

  • Develop, test, and maintain high-quality software using Python programming language.
  • Design and implement effective and scalable solutions to store and retrieve organization data.
  • Responsible for the architecture, modeling, design, development, testing, implementation and maintenance of the ETL, procedures and structures which populate and grow our databases, data marts and tables.
  • Provide direction to less experienced ETL developers on solution design and implementation. Ensuring standards are being followed.
  • Work with stakeholders including the business analytics teams and IS architecture teams to assist with data-related technical issues and support their data infrastructure needs.

Key Skills and Qualifications

  • 7+ years' experience in building scalable enterprise data integration solutions; preferred on the Microsoft SQL Server, nice to have Azure Data Warehouse/Database platforms.
  • 3+ years of experience as a Python Developer with a strong portfolio of projects.
  • In-depth understanding of the Python software development stacks, ecosystems, frameworks and tools such as Numpy, Pandas, Pyarrow.
  • Proficient understanding of code versioning tools such as Git.
  • Proficiency with data integration tools such as SSIS and Azure Data Factory (ADF), in-depth hands-on experience with SQL, TSQL, and data formats such as XML and JSON. SSIS and T-SQL is necessary. ADF is nice to have.
  • Experience with continuous integration/continuous deployment (CI/CD) pipelines and tools.